Join Our Team as a Human Resources Manager
We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Human Resources Manager to join our team in Riyadh. As an HR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ing and managing all aspects of human resources operations, ensuring that the company maintains a positive work environment, fosters employee engagement, and complies with local labor laws.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Recruitment & Staffing: Lead the recruitment process, including job postings, candidate screening, interviewing, and selection. Collaborate with department heads to ensure timely and effective hiring of talent.
  • Employee Relations & Engagement: Foster a positive work environment by managing employee relations, addressing grievances, and ensuring effective communication between management and staff. Implement employee engagement programs to improve morale and retention.
  • Training & Development: Identify training needs and organize development programs to improve employee skills and performance. Support career development initiatives and leadership training.
  • Performance Management: Oversee performance management processes, ensuring regular feedback, appraisals, and goal-setting for all employees.
  • Compensation & Benefits: Administer salary and benefits programs, ensuring alignment with market standards and company policies.
  • Compliance & Policies: Ensure that all HR practices comply with Saudi labor laws and company policies.
  • HR Strategy & Reporting: Collaborate with senior management to align HR strategies with the company’s overall goals.
  • HR Systems & Administration: Manage and maintain HR databases and records.

Qualifications:
  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ources Management, Business Administration, or a related field. HR certifications (such as CIPD) are a plus.
  • Experience: Minimum of 5 years of experience in HR management or a related role, with at least 2 years in a managerial capacity.
  • Skills: In-depth knowledge of Saudi labor laws and regulations, strong leadership and decision-making abilities,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, and proficiency in HR software and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Personal Attributes: Strong attention to detail, problem-solving skills, ability to work under pressure, proactive and results-oriented approach, and high level of professionalism and confidentiality.
